> > Does any one know how to include imagesc in
> subplot as
> > Matlab?
> >
> > In matlab, it is easy to combine image and graphs
> in
> > subplots. For example
> >
> > data=rand(100,100);
> >
> > x=0:0.1:pi*2;
> >
> > subplot(1,2,1); imagesc(data);
> > subplot(1,2,2); plot(sin(x));
> >
> > This will plot two figures together.
> >
> > However, the above will not work in Octave.
> >
> 
> Historically, gnuplot could not handle images (it
> has changed just recently).
> As a result octave had to use different program to
> display them.
> So, no, currently you cannot combine images and
> plots
> in octave easily. You may want to look at
> http://www.epstk.de/
> for similar capabilities.
